1250 kVA AVR / Servo

The 1250 kVA Automatic Voltage Regulator / Servo Controlled Voltage Stabilizer is designed to provide stable and reliable voltage supply under fluctuating power conditions. In many industrial and commercial installations, voltage variations result in excessive current flow, particularly affecting smaller capacity motors up to 7.5 H.P.

For over five decades, POWER Engineers & Consultants (Regd.), known in the industry by the trusted brand name POWER, has remained one of India’s most respected names in the manufacturing of Automatic Voltage Regulators (AVRs), Servo Voltage Stabilizers, Rectifiers, and Power Transformers. Established on a foundation of engineering excellence, the company has consistently delivered solutions that combine technical precision, robust performance, and long-term reliability.

When supply voltage drops below the required level, electrical motors draw higher current to maintain output torque. This excessive current adversely affects motors and associated electrical equipment, leading to increased losses, overheating, and premature equipment failure.

The TM POWER AVR / Servo effectively controls these voltage fluctuations and maintains stable output voltage, ensuring safe and efficient operation of motors and connected systems.

Effects of Higher Current on Electrical Motors

Higher current caused by low voltage conditions affects electrical motors in the following ways:

• Increased Motor Losses

Higher current produces increased electrical losses in motors, resulting in:

  • Excessive heating
  • Insulation deterioration
  • Premature winding failure
  • Reduced motor life

This problem is particularly severe in smaller motors up to 7.5 H.P.
